Why Responsible Gambling Features Matter at New Online Casinos
The online gambling landscape is more regulated than ever before, and that’s a positive development for players. New online casinos launching today must meet strict standards around responsible gambling before they can obtain and maintain a licence. But compliance is a minimum standard, not the ceiling — the truly standout new online gambling sites go above and beyond regulatory requirements to create a playing environment that actively supports player wellbeing.
For players, this means more tools, more transparency, and more genuinely supportive systems than existed even five years ago. Understanding what these tools are and how to use them puts you in control of your gambling experience from the very first session.
Essential Responsible Gambling Tools at New Online Betting Sites
Deposit Limits
The most widely used responsible gambling tool, deposit limits allow you to set a maximum amount you can deposit per day, week, or month. Limits take effect immediately when reduced, but increases typically require a 24-hour cooling-off period — a deliberate friction that prevents impulsive decisions during a difficult session. Setting a deposit limit when you first register at a new online casino is strongly recommended.
Loss Limits
Similar to deposit limits but focused on outcomes rather than inputs, loss limits cap the total amount you can lose over a defined period. Once reached, further play is blocked until the limit period resets. This is particularly useful for players who play through large deposits quickly.
Session Time Limits and Reality Checks
Time can pass very quickly during an engaging casino session. Session time limits automatically log you out after a specified period of continuous play. Reality checks are gentler — a pop-up reminder that appears every 30, 60, or 90 minutes telling you how long you’ve been playing and how much you’ve won or lost, prompting a conscious decision about whether to continue.
Cool-Off Periods
A cool-off or time-out period temporarily suspends your account for a chosen duration — typically 24 hours, 48 hours, one week, or one month. Unlike self-exclusion, cool-off periods are temporary and your account reactivates automatically at the end of the period. They’re designed for players who want a short break without committing to permanent exclusion.
Self-Exclusion
The most serious responsible gambling tool available at new online gambling sites, self-exclusion allows you to permanently close your account for a minimum period — usually six months to five years. During this period you cannot register a new account at the same operator. Self-exclusion requests must be processed promptly and the operator must make all reasonable efforts to prevent you from circumventing the restriction.
GamStop – National Self-Exclusion for UK Players
GamStop is the UK’s national self-exclusion register. Registering with GamStop allows you to self-exclude from all online gambling operators licensed to serve UK customers simultaneously, in a single step. This is far more effective than self-excluding from individual casinos, as it prevents the common pattern of excluding from one site only to open an account at another.
GamStop exclusions last a minimum of six months and can be extended to one or five years. Registration is free, takes a few minutes, and takes effect within 24 hours. If you feel you need a break from gambling, GamStop is the single most impactful action you can take.
GambleAware – Independent Support and Information
GambleAware is the UK’s leading charity focused on reducing gambling-related harm. They provide free, confidential support for anyone affected by gambling — whether you are concerned about your own habits or those of someone you care about. The GambleAware website provides self-assessment tools, advice on talking to someone about a gambling problem, and links to specialist treatment services.
GambleAware also runs the National Gambling Helpline, which provides free telephone and live chat support 24 hours a day, seven days a week. There is no obligation and no judgement — simply confidential support from trained advisors.
How to Assess a New Online Casino’s Commitment to Responsible Gambling
When considering joining any new online gambling site, look for these positive indicators of genuine responsible gambling commitment:
- Responsible gambling tools accessible from the main account menu, not buried in the settings
- Clear, prominent links to GambleAware and GamStop on the casino homepage and in the footer
- Age verification checks at registration — not just at first withdrawal
- Proactive outreach if player behaviour suggests potential harm — unusual deposit patterns, extended sessions
- Trained customer support staff who can signpost players to help without judgement
- A clearly stated corporate responsible gambling policy, not just a page of links

Setting Your Own Limits – Practical Advice for New Players
Before you play at any new online casino for the first time, we recommend taking five minutes to establish clear personal boundaries:
- Decide in advance how much you are comfortable losing — not winning, losing. Treat it like a night out budget
- Set a deposit limit at the casino that reflects this figure before you make your first deposit
- Set a session time limit so you have a natural stopping point
- Never chase losses — if you reach your loss limit, stop, and return another day if you choose
- Never gamble with money that is allocated to essential expenses
Gambling is meant to be an enjoyable form of entertainment. Kept in that context, with clear boundaries, the experience at the latest online casinos can be genuinely rewarding. If it ever starts to feel like anything other than entertainment, please use the tools available and seek support.
